Method and system for using application packaging in high-performance computing environment

A high-performance computing and high-performance technology, applied in software deployment, version control, software maintenance/management, etc., can solve problems such as cumbersome processes

Active Publication Date: 2018-02-02
COMP NETWORK INFORMATION CENT CHINESE ACADEMY OF SCI
View PDF4 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Users need to log in to different systems and submit jobs with various commands through different scheduling software. The process is cumbersome

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and system for using application packaging in high-performance computing environment
  • Method and system for using application packaging in high-performance computing environment

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0020] The technical solutions of the present invention will be described in further detail below with reference to the accompanying drawings and embodiments.

[0021] Below to figure 1 As an example, a system using application packaging in a high-performance computing environment according to an embodiment of the present invention will be described in detail.

[0022] figure 1 It is a schematic structural diagram of an application packaging system used in a high-performance computing environment provided by an embodiment of the present invention. Such as figure 1 As shown, the system includes a basic information collection unit, a job description unit, a job scheduler unit, an application encapsulation and analysis unit, and one or more high-performance computers.

[0023] Specifically, the application encapsulation and parsing unit generates an application encapsulation executable file; the basic information collection unit acquires one or more basic information of the ap...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ention relates to a method and a system for using application packaging in a high-performance computing environment. The method comprises the steps of generating an application packaging executable file; obtaining basic application packaging information of one or more high-performance computers; according to a job description request of a user, obtaining job description information; matching the job description information in the basic application packaging information to obtain the application package executable file corresponding to the job description information; if the matching succeeds, analyzing the job description information, and according to an analysis result, the matched application packaging executable file and a job management system type, generating a job submitting script; and sending the job submitting script to the one or more high-performance computers, thereby finishing job submitting. The heterogeneity of application software deployment in the high-performance computing environment can be shielded; and a unified usage environment is provided for users.

Description

technical field [0001] The invention relates to the field of computer applications, in particular to a method and system for using application packaging in a high-performance computing environment. Background technique [0002] In the high-performance computing environment, different high-performance computers have different application installation versions, different paths, and different execution environment settings. Users need to log in to different systems and submit jobs with various commands through different scheduling software, which is a cumbersome process. [0003] Therefore, users need to shield the above heterogeneity in the high-performance computing environment when using it, and provide the application software and related version information deployed in the environment by automatic means for users to understand, choose to use, and use various data statistics. At the same time, realize the rapid parsing of user job requests and convert them into job executi...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F8/61G06F8/71
CPCG06F8/61G06F8/71
Inventor 王小宁肖海力曹荣强卢莎莎武虹
Owner COMP NETWORK INFORMATION CENT CHINESE ACADEMY OF SCI
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products